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41 24716 84394 210241
0481688 49826394821 725
0481688 49826394821 725
30 919 988 778087390 87222405
All about undefined
Interested in learning more?
0481688 49826394821 725
30 919 988 778087390 87222405
See more
7928 55898374 767
60887668638 2634830626 72108
See more
460 4336354 60689
8960580 568 8635203
See more